Electrical outlets available for tailgating at UAM
MONTICELLO — A new feature is available this year for Arkansas-Monticello football tailgaters.
Eight electrical outlets are available through out the tailgating area along the east side of Weevil Pond. The cost for each outlet for the entire season is $75.

Warren Junior Auxiliary golf fundraiser Sept. 15
WARREN — A two-man golf scramble fundraiser for the Warren Junior Auxiliary will be held Sept. 15 at Warren Country Club.
Proceeds from the sixth annual golf tournament will help fund the following services for children: Angel Tree, Back-to-School supply drive, activities during Relay for Life, and others. Report: Lady Lions sign Thompson
ROCKFORD, Ill. — The Arkansas-Pine Bluff women’s basketball team landed a recruit from an Illinois junior college, a Rockford TV station reported.
Marion Thompson, a first-team NJCAA All-American selection for national champion Rock Valley College, signed with the Lady Lions according to WREX-TV. She also was named to the NJCAA all-tournament, all-region and all-conference teams as a sophomore, averaging 12.9 points and 12.6 rebounds per game. She was second on the team in blocked shots with 45.
Arkansas State blanks UAPB in women’s soccer
JONESBORO — Arkansas-Pine Bluff fell to 0-2 on the young women’s soccer season as it suffered its second straight shutout loss, 6-0 to Arkansas State on Sunday.
Arkansas State (1-1) got goals from Jena Kelly, Ashley McMurtry, Christina Fink, Loren Mitchell, Christina Giles and Aja Aguirre.
UAPB did not attempt a shot on goal in the first half, but Amanda Lee made two saves for A-State.
UAPB will host Western Illinois on Friday and Louisiana-Monroe on Sunday, both games starting at 4 p.m. ULM coach Roberto Mazza will face his old team, which he guided to two SWAC championships.

‘College Football Confidential: Arkansas’ to debut on cable channel
A behind-the-scenes look at the University of Arkansas football team will debut Aug. 29 on the CBS Sports Network.
“College Football Confidential: Arkansas” includes seven episodes and is complemented by all-access online content now available at CBSSports.com/collegefootballconfidential.
Athletic director Jeff Long, head coach John L. Smith and players Tyler Wilson and Knile Davis are featured in the show.
